Games Workshop Group PLC Declares Dividend of GBX 85 (LON:GAW)

Games Workshop Group PLC (LON:GAWGet Free Report) declared a dividend on Wednesday, October 16th, Upcoming.Co.Uk reports. Investors of record on Thursday, October 24th will be paid a dividend of GBX 85 ($1.11) per share on Friday, November 29th. This represents a yield of 0.73%. The ex-dividend date is Thursday, October 24th. The official announcement can be accessed at this link.

Games Workshop Group Company Profile

Games Workshop Group PLC, together with its subsidiaries, designs, manufactures, distributes, and sells miniature figures and games in the United Kingdom, Continental Europe, North America, Australia, New Zealand, Asia, and internationally. It operates in two segments, Core and Licensing. The company offers games under the Warhammer: Age of Sigmar, Necromunda, and Warhammer 40,000 names, as well as Horus Heresy and Blood Bowl.
